What degree is supposed to reference? It's not mentioned in the three degrees in the 2 versions I learned nor in the 3rd one I'm learning now. i don't recall reference to owls is Scottish Rite or Shrine either.
A night hunting bird - Most lodges meet in the evening. The owl is the mascot of Athena Greek goddess of wisdom - Wisdom is one of the symbols of the Worshipful Master of the local lodges. If some regular jurisdiction were to have an owl mentioned in their version of the ritual it would work okay.
The owl has long been a symbol of wisdom, rather then intelligence. A smart person can still be blindsided by darkness, a wise person sees threw the darkness, as does the owl.
